Product Overview
The MarknStamp STALLION-XL-STATION is a professional-grade, industrial-strength laser marking machine designed for high-volume production and versatile marking applications across various industries. This robust and ergonomic workstation features a large 650x500x300mm working area, accommodating components up to 300mm in height, and is equipped with a powerful fiber laser, CO2 laser, or UV OEM laser with output powers ranging from 30W to 120W.

High-Speed Marking
Equipped with high-power fiber, CO2, or UV lasers for ultra-fast marking speeds up to 7000 mm/s.
